sarcastic in Indonesian is sarkastis — sarcastic means marked by sarcasm; mocking through statements that mean the opposite of what they literally say.

sarcastic in a sentence
- He gave a sarcastic round of applause when she finally arrived, an hour late.
- Her sarcastic tone made it clear she didn't believe a word of it.
